AI Summary
-
Requires clerks of circuit court to electronically time stamp all papers and electronic filings, and store electronic filings with appropriate security measures.
-
Prohibits clerks from charging fees to view or print docket copies via the Internet, effective July 1, 2013.
-
Authorizes clerks to remove sealed or expunged court records from Official Records pursuant to court orders.
-
Lowers the automatic overpayment refund threshold from $10 to $5 and allows state agencies and court officers to access public records without paying copying fees.
-
Allows electronic proof of publication affidavits in lieu of paper format and requires specific information to maintain public records exemption status for sensitive personal information like social security numbers and bank account numbers.
